The Historic Role of Liquor in Cultures Worldwide
Throughout background, liquor has worked as a considerable cultural component, shaping social interactions throughout varied societies. In ancient civilizations, such as Mesopotamia and Egypt, alcohol was typically considered as a present from the gods, used in spiritual ceremonies and public banquets. The Greeks commemorated the red wine god Dionysus, highlighting the web link in between drunkenness and social bonding. In middle ages Europe, taverns became hubs for community interaction, where people gathered to share stories and build links. As cultures advanced, so did the role of liquor; it came to be a symbol of hospitality and sociability. Distinct traditions surrounding alcohol created, reflecting local personalizeds and values. From the sake of Japan to the tequila of Mexico, these beverages not just boosted culinary experiences but likewise promoted a feeling of identification and belonging. The historic significance of liquor exposes its long-lasting impact on social characteristics throughout the globe.

History of Toasting
Throughout background, the act of raising a glass has actually acted as a powerful routine that fosters link among people. Coming from ancient times, toasting was a means to guarantee trust fund among drinkers, as sharing a beverage symbolized an absence of sick intent. The Greeks and Romans raised this practice, utilizing it to honor gods and commemorate success. In middle ages Europe, toasting ended up being a social norm, usually gone along with by elaborate speeches to memorialize friendship and a good reputation. As cultures progressed, so did the subtleties of toasting, with each culture embedding its one-of-a-kind custom-mades and meanings. Today, toasting stays a global gesture, representing sociability and shared experiences, reinforcing bonds that transcend generations and geographical borders.
